ORGEL PLUS STIMME "I can only imagine"
Sunday, September 7, 2025 | 5:00 PM
International Organ Concerts Konz, Parish Church of St. Nicholas, Konz
Eva-Maria Leonardy, soprano
Prof. Karl Ludwig Kreutz, organ
With a truly unexpected format, the concert featuring the breathtaking soprano Eva-Maria Leonardy and the versatile organist and professor of improvisation Karl Ludwig Kreutz promises to captivate and enthrall. In a blend of Gregorian chant, pop, classical, jazz, and film music, diverse genres converge in the spirit of Albert Schweitzer: "All music that is truly and deeply felt, whether secular or sacred, walks on those heights where art and religion can always meet." Aurally rich, heart-stirring, and even unheard-of soundscapes form the heart of a truly unique concert experience – goosebumps guaranteed!
